Output 74fedc357ef9207caa0dc890fb82bd8ad4e88aab594e021ef29e762b4ebae9f7:79

value
9912291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ffcb634efda74aa3f873e50b90a1a430a5897ca OP_EQUAL
address
364kRHB4PgTFJTh2TtY99TyWhVXDA4iMcu
transaction
74fedc357ef9207caa0dc890fb82bd8ad4e88aab594e021ef29e762b4ebae9f7
confirmations
253786
spent
true